Our Annual Graduate Conference is a major event in our Department, and an integral part of your postgraduate experience.

The conference takes place in April every year at the Westcliff Hotel, Southend-On-Sea. It brings us together to share our work, discuss ideas and make new connections, drawing on the wide range of research currently going on in the department.

The programme is put together each year by a small planning group of students and staff. We encourage creative thinking in the range of presentation formats and endeavour to include skills-based sessions alongside theoretical ones. In previous years for example, these have focused on dissertation writing, preparing for vivas and first publications.

The conference gives you the chance to meet with fellow students and staff in an informal but intellectually stimulating environment and to make new friends.

Join the planning group

The conference programme is developed by a small group of Masters and PhD students who are recruited in the Autumn term, together with our Graduate Directors of Research and Taught programmes and our Student Support Services Officer.

Being part of the planning group is not heavily time-consuming and allows you to have a real impact on programme content, both intellectual and social.
